Nasal Aspirators (Frida, Sweetie and Sovarcate)
Nasal aspirators consist of a nozzle that you position at the opening of your baby’s nostril, a long piece of soft tubing in the middle, and a mouthpiece on the other end. Most nasal aspirators are parent-powered – you use your mouth to pull mucus out of your child’s nose.
